Scale-out architecture:
Distributed fully symmetric clustered architecture that combines modular storage with OneFS operating system in a single volume, single namespace and single filesystem
Modular design:
Four self-contained Isilon nodes include server, software, HDDs and SSDs in a 4U rack-mountable chassis. 1U or 2U Rack-mountable PowerScale node that integrates into existing PowerScale and Isilon clusters with backend Ethernet or InfiniBand connectivity
Operating system: PowerScale OneFS distributed file system creates a cluster with a single file system and single global namespace. It is fully journaled, fully distributed, and has a globally coherent write/read cache
High availability: No-single-point-of-failure. Self-healing design protects against disk or node failure; includes back-end intra-cluster failover
Scalability: A cluster can scale up to 252 nodes. Minimum number of Isilon nodes per cluster is four. Minimum number of PowerScale all-flash nodes per cluster is three. Add nodes to scale performance and capacity
Data protection: FlexProtect file-level striping with support for N+1 through N+4 and mirroring data protection schemes
2-way NDMP: Supports two ports of Fibre Channel (8G) that allows for two-way NDMP connections and two ports of standard 10GbE connectivity
Data retention: SmartLock policy-based retention and protection against accidental deletion
Security: File system audit capability to improve security and control of your storage infrastructure and address regulatory compliance requirements
Efficiency:
SmartDedupe data deduplication option, which can reduce storage requirements by up to 35 percent. Inline data reduction and compression available on F200, F600, F900, F810 and H5600
Automated storage tiering:
Policy-based automated tiering options including SmartPools and CloudPools software to optimize storage resources and lower costs
